Yep, been waiting for this day. I even remember wondering the day of surgery what will it be like in one year and I was scared...would I be alive, feel well, be successful with weight loss, have any hair, etc. After surgery I cried after a few days bc eating less was so foreign. I mourned my tummy in the trash, my friend, my companion, my reliable partner in crime. I was a bit sad, strangely. End of an era.
But I must tell you I am alive, I feel really great, I have been successful in losing a huge amount of weight, and I do have hair that I grew out kinda long.
Today my health is much better than a year ago. I wear a 30" waist pant now or a size 8Petite or a Small or Medium shirt. A year ago I was wearing a size 20WP and a 2X. I looked so swollen in every way.
What is next during the next year? Well...definitely losing the rest, not regaining, firming it up, lasiks eye surgery, and giving the girls a lil lift.
